Output b677567306094d02605316aa6a8418ab085f52889edd33be0d9b6aa28056e281:0

value
12301302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c73845319309909fd68675c9714d2ed4ae245c0 OP_EQUAL
address
3D346atjNCyS1k5MZgwWdicaBSWXjAiHb8
transaction
b677567306094d02605316aa6a8418ab085f52889edd33be0d9b6aa28056e281
confirmations
345009
spent
true